A federal judge just blocked the Justice Department’s attempt to subpoena personal info of every 2020 Fulton County election worker, calling the request overly broad and politically motivated. The judge ruled the scope was unreasonable, the statute of limitations had passed, and grand juries aren’t meant for fishing expeditions — only for investigating crimes. The DOJ won’t get the list, setting a major precedent on how federal agencies can use subpoenas in election-related investigations.
